LDAP2DOC -nutzen Sie Ihr Active Directory effektiver und Ihre Vorlagen schneller-
Die Seite wird von mir betrieben, mich würde Interessieren ob mein Programm am Markt ankommt, Würde mich über Reaktion von Euch sehr freuen.
Danke
Stefan
ldap2doc.de
Danke
Stefan
ldap2doc.de
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 199984
Url: https://administrator.de/forum/ldap2doc-nutzen-sie-ihr-active-directory-effektiver-und-ihre-vorlagen-schneller-199984.html
Ausgedruckt am: 07.07.2025 um 21:07 Uhr
4 Kommentare
Neuester Kommentar
Warum bezahlen wenns umsonst ist ?
Private Sub Document_New()
On Error Resume Next
Dim objSystemInfo As Object
Dim objUser As Object
Set WSHShell = CreateObject("WScript.Shell")
Set objSystemInfo = CreateObject("ADSystemInfo")
Set objUser = GetObject("LDAP://" & objSystemInfo.UserName)
Set fs = CreateObject("Scripting.FileSystemObject")
CurrentUser = WSHShell.ExpandEnvironmentStrings("%USERNAME%")
ActiveDocument.FormFields("Vorname").Result = objUser.FirstName
ActiveDocument.FormFields("Nachname").Result = objUser.LastName
ActiveDocument.FormFields("UnserZeichen").Result = LCase(Left(objUser.LastName, 2))
ActiveDocument.FormFields("Telefon").Result = objUser.TelephoneNumber
ActiveDocument.FormFields("Telefax").Result = objUser.facsimileTelephoneNumber
ActiveDocument.FormFields("Mail").Result = objUser.EmailAddress
Set objUser = Nothing
Set objSystemInfo = Nothing
End Sub
Private Sub Document_New()
On Error Resume Next
Dim objSystemInfo As Object
Dim objUser As Object
Set WSHShell = CreateObject("WScript.Shell")
Set objSystemInfo = CreateObject("ADSystemInfo")
Set objUser = GetObject("LDAP://" & objSystemInfo.UserName)
Set fs = CreateObject("Scripting.FileSystemObject")
CurrentUser = WSHShell.ExpandEnvironmentStrings("%USERNAME%")
ActiveDocument.FormFields("Vorname").Result = objUser.FirstName
ActiveDocument.FormFields("Nachname").Result = objUser.LastName
ActiveDocument.FormFields("UnserZeichen").Result = LCase(Left(objUser.LastName, 2))
ActiveDocument.FormFields("Telefon").Result = objUser.TelephoneNumber
ActiveDocument.FormFields("Telefax").Result = objUser.facsimileTelephoneNumber
ActiveDocument.FormFields("Mail").Result = objUser.EmailAddress
Set objUser = Nothing
Set objSystemInfo = Nothing
End Sub